Hey guys, I've been a way for a while, good to be back. But I've got front door window problems.
1. Driver's side door window. About every other time I lower my window I get an audible POP and it appears a little shimmy out of the forward portion of the window.
2. Passanger side from door window. I got the POP once of that side but now, than window will rollup all the way but the last half inch.
I'm about to take the inside door panel off and see what I can see. Anyone had this experience? Any pointers would be appreciated.

Yes we all have experienced that.. well maybe not all of us.
There is a plastic wheel on the regulator that is breaking or broken off, the peg that holds the wheel is getting jammed in a hole and "popping" back out of it. You need to replace the wheel before you damage the motor... here are a couple links to fixes.
